ITM 912  Information Technology Transactional Perspectives

Semester:
Spring of even years
Credits:
Total Credits: 3   Lecture/Recitation/Discussion Hours: 3
Recommended Background:
Graduate level microeconomics course
Restrictions:
Open only to doctoral students.
Description:
Multiple perspectives on relationships between organizations and information technology. Information processing, communications and management strategy approaches. Economic perspectives.
Effective Dates:
FS03 - SS08
